

It is with great sadness that we announce Benton Ray Maxwell, age 75, of Kansas City, Kansas passed away unexpectedly at the AdventHealth Shawnee Mission Medical Center on Thursday, February 17, 2022. Benton was born on August 2, 1946, in Monterey, Tennessee to his loving parents Pete and Josephine Maxwell.

Benton was a hard-working, selfless father and grandfather who never sat still. He was a man of many trades and talents. Benton served his country in the Air Force. He was a great mechanic, known to fix-up and race some pretty amazing cars. Benton spent most of his working career working alongside his brother, Danny Maxwell. Together they built Danny’s company, DJ’s Foundation and Flatwork. He had a love for all things motorcycle, including spending time riding with his close friends and family whenever he had the chance. If he was not out riding or in the garage working on a car, you would find him working in his amazing garden every summer—sending his freshly homegrown produce home with others for them to enjoy too!
